ABA therapy helps children learn to communicate, build social awareness, and develop flexibility. At Brightwork, we use a naturalistic, play-based approach. We follow your child's lead, turning their interests into learning opportunities.

A Board Certified Behavior Analyst (BCBA) will conduct a comprehensive assessment to recommend a schedule based on your child's needs. Comprehensive programs range from 25 to 40 hours per week, while focused programs for specific goals are 10-25 hours per week.

Children without a diagnosis can access our PEERS® Certified Social Skills Program. To access insurance-funded ABA therapy, a medical diagnosis of Autism Spectrum Disorder (ASD) is required from a psychologist, neurologist, or developmental pediatrician. If you suspect your child may be on the Autism Spectrum but hasn't been diagnosed, we can refer you to trusted diagnostic partners in the South Bay.
